Satpara Lake also spelled Sadpara Lake ({{langx|ur|سدپارہ جھیل}}) is a natural lake near Skardu in the Gilgit-Baltistan region of Pakistan. The lake supplies water to Skardu Valley.{{cite news |last1=Azad |first1=Mukhtar |title=سدپارہ جھیل آخری سانس لے رہی ہے |trans-title=Sadpara Lake is taking its last breath |url=https://www.bbc.com/urdu/pakistan/story/2004/08/040825_sadpara_mukhtar_nad |access-date=17 April 2025 |work=BBC Urdu |date=26 August 2004 |lang=ur}}{{cite news |last1=Hussain |first1=Anam |title=Guardians of the glaciers - life beside Pakistan's vanishing ice |url=https://www.aljazeera.com/features/longform/2024/5/12/guardians-of-the-glaciers-life-alongside-pakistans-vanishing-ice |access-date=17 November 2024 |work=Al Jazeera |date=12 May 2024}} Fed by the Satpara Stream originating from the Deosai plains, the stream is the lake's only outlet. Satpara Lake is situated at an elevation of {{convert|2600|m}} above sea level and spans an area of {{convert|4|km2}}. It provides habitat to the brown and rainbow trout fishes which were introduced in the region.{{cite book |editor=T. Petr |title=Fish and fisheries at higher altitudes: Asia (385) |url=https://books.google.com/books?id=Z4HESCeJyZcC |year=1999 |publisher=Food and Agriculture Organization of the United Nations |location=Rome |isbn=92-5-104309-4 |page=134}}

History

Traditional accounts attribute the damming of the Satpara Stream to the Balti king Ali Sher Khan Anchan (1595–1633).{{Cite book |last=Hauptmann |first=Harald |author-link=Harald Hauptmann |url= |title=Lords of the Mountains: Pre-Islamic Heritage Along the Upper Indus in Pakistan |date=2024 |publisher=Heidelberg University Publishing |isbn=978-3-96822-270-7 |editor-last=Olivieri |editor-first=Luca Maria |pages=59–60 |language=en |chapter=Archaeology and Anthropology in the Northern Areas}}

The completion of Satpara Dam downstream of the lake has enlarged the size of Satpara Lake.[https://web.archive.org/web/20101201180054/http://wapda.gov.pk/htmls/sataparapj.html Satpara Project]

Physical features

The melting snow from the Deosai Plains is the main source of water for the lake.{{cite journal |last1=Hussain |first1=H. |last2=Mahmood |first2=S. |last3=Khalid |first3=A. |title=Seasonal variation in non-point source heavy metal pollution in Satpara Lake and its toxicity in trout fish |journal=Environmental Monitoring and Assessment |date=July 2023 |volume=195 |issue=7 |page=901 |doi=10.1007/s10661-023-11498-x|pmid=37380756 |bibcode=2023EMnAs.195..901H }} At a height of {{convert|2600|m}}, the lake is centered with an area of 4 km with a picturesque island.
